| ## Exploring a UTXO | ||||
| ### Exploring a UTXO | ||||
| 
 | ||||
| To get details of a UTXO, we first need to get its `hex` id, which we can then decode using `decoderawtransaction`. | ||||
| You can similarly use `listunspent` to get an array of UTXOs on your system: | ||||
| 
 | ||||
| ```py | ||||
| print("Exploring UTXOs") | ||||
| @ -226,12 +216,21 @@ print("Utxos: ") | ||||
| print("-----") | ||||
| pprint(utxos) | ||||
| print("------------------------------------------\n") | ||||
| ``` | ||||
| 
 | ||||
| In order to manipulate an array like the one returned from `listtransactions` or `listunpsent`, you just grab the appropriate item from the appropriate element of the array: | ||||
| ``` | ||||
| ## Select a UTXO - first one selected here | ||||
| utxo_txid = utxos[0]['txid'] | ||||
| ## Get UTXO Hex | ||||
| ``` | ||||
| 
 | ||||
| For `listunspent`, you get a `txid`. You can retrieve information about it with `gettransaction`, then decode that with `decoderawtransaction`: | ||||
| 
 | ||||
| ``` | ||||
| utxo_hex = rpc_client.gettransaction(utxo_txid)['hex'] | ||||
| ## Get tx Details | ||||
| 
 | ||||
| utxo_tx_details = rpc_client.decoderawtransaction(utxo_hex) | ||||
| 
 | ||||
| print("Details of Utxo with txid:", utxo_txid) | ||||
| print("---------------------------------------------------------------") | ||||
| print("UTXO Details:") | ||||
| @ -240,6 +239,101 @@ pprint(utxo_tx_details) | ||||
| print("---------------------------------------------------------------\n") | ||||
| ``` | ||||
